CVE-2019-6630 affects specific F5 SSL Orchestrator 14.0 and 14.1 releases. Certain undisclosed traffic flows may cause F5's Traffic Management Microkernel to restart, creating an availability risk for traffic handled by the device. Exposure is limited to organizations running the named F5 SSL Orchestrator versions. Impact is most relevant where SSL Orchestrator processes production traffic paths. Treat as an availability-risk review item, not a confirmed active-exploitation emergency. Escalate priority if affected devices sit in critical traffic paths. Mitigation focus: Identify any F5 SSL Orchestrator deployments on affected 14.0 or 14.1 versions.; Review F5 advisory K33444350 for fixed versions or vendor-approved mitigations.; Prioritize remediation for devices in production traffic paths..
